Git rebase atlassian
Rebase is one of two Git utilities that specializes in integrating changes from one branch onto another. The other change integration utility is git merge. Merge is always a forward moving change record. Alternatively, rebase has powerful history rewriting features. For a detailed look at Merge vs. Rebase, visit … See more The primary reason for rebasing is to maintain a linear project history. For example, consider a situation where the master branch has progressed since you started working on a feature branch. You want to get the latest … See more One caveat to consider when working with Git Rebase is merge conflicts may become more frequent during a rebase workflow. This … See more In this article we covered git rebaseusage. We discussed basic and advanced use cases and more advanced examples. Some key discussion points are: 1. git rebase standard vs interactive modes 2. git rebase … See more If another user has rebased and force pushed to the branch that you’re committing to, a git pull will then overwrite any commits you … See more WebIt is possible that a merge failure will prevent this process from being completely automatic. You will have to resolve any such merge failure and run git rebase --continue.Another …
Git rebase atlassian
Did you know?
WebSep 7, 2024 · git branch -D detached-branch 0 seconds of 1 minute, 13 secondsVolume 0% 00:25 01:13 Rebasing Instead of Merging You could also do a rebase. Rebases are different from merges in that they rewrite the branch history, lifting up the detached commits and moving them to the front of the branch. Web$ git bisect reset By default, this will return your tree to the commit that was checked out before git bisect start. (A new git bisect start will also do that, as it cleans up the old bisection state.) With an optional argument, you can return to a different commit instead: $ git bisect reset
WebRebase, fast-forward (rebase + merge --ff-only): Commits from the source branch onto the target branch, creating a new non-merge commit for each incoming commit. Fast-forwards the target branch with the resulting commits. The PR … WebMar 14, 2024 · Is typing git config --global pull.rebase true in Git Bash equivalent to checking the box in Sourcetree: Tools -> Options -> Git -> Use rebase instead of merge by default for tracked branches? Answer Watch Like Be the first to like this Share 2167 views 1 answer 0 votes minnsey Atlassian Team Mar 19, 2024 Hi
WebSep 17, 2014 · git rebase atlassian-sourcetree merge-conflict-resolution Share Follow asked Sep 17, 2014 at 10:11 user4007604 Just to check: Did you do a git rebase --continue after fixing the conflict? – Robert Rüger Sep 17, 2014 at 10:33 @Robert - No, I clicked the 'commit' button. – user4007604 Sep 17, 2014 at 10:35 2 WebFeb 18, 2024 · The purpose of resetting the head back is to remove the latest changes that have made your repo exceed the limit, not to re-write your history. If you'd like to rewrite your history that's also possible, although a more complex operation. My recommendation would be to run the following command to see how much space your repo is taking locally:
WebHost: GitHub Forking Forking One main development branch (main, master, trunk, etc.). Adding a new feature, fixing a bug, etc.: create a new branch -- a
http://duoduokou.com/git/27633927626592271080.html books for 11 year old girlWebMay 11, 2016 · Дебаты на тему «Merge vs Rebase» часто встречаются на просторах интернета (поисковики подскажут). У Atlassian, кстати, есть хорошая статья, в которой описывается разница этих двух подходов. Так в чем же ... harvey animal crossing new horizonsWebFeb 21, 2024 · 如果您真的很菜鸟,我的建议是从git存储库中下载项目的最新更新。 然后创建新的存储库,并将其推向初始存储库。 这是最简单,最简单的方法。 有关更高级的解 … books for 12 year olds australiaWebAug 28, 2024 · Rebase starts out by selecting which commits to copy using the two-dot notation described in the gitrevisions documentation: master..feature (the name feature comes from your current branch, the one you have checked out; the name master comes from your argument to git rebase ). harvey aopsWebFeb 9, 2024 · Git Rebase là gì? Hiểu một cách nôm na thì Git Rebase là một chức năng của Git, được sử dụng để nhập một branch đã gần hoàn thiện vào branch gốc (branch master). harvey animal hospital grosse pointeWebOct 7, 2024 · Here is the correct way to do the git interactive rebase In the global .gitconfig (under the mac home directory, hidden file), setup the following and it will help your interactive rebase. It... books for 12 year olds fictionWebA free Git client for Windows and Mac Sourcetree simplifies how you interact with your Git repositories so you can focus on coding. Visualize and manage your repositories through Sourcetree's simple Git GUI. Simple for beginners harvey animal hospital detroit